1964 Buick Riviera

  Some cars are born to race down a quarter-mile track, while others

  were created solely to carve up canyons and autocross events. But

  some cars are neither of those things because they were born to

  just cruise. While a 1964 Buick Riviera Super Wildcat might not be

  the first car you think of when it comes to cool classics, this one

  might just be the last car you'll ever shop for.

  The chill Wedgewood Blue repaint gives this car the calming

  serenity of the coastal resort destination of its namesake. Kept

  mostly to its original outward factory form, this Wildcat is

  capable of purring along the interstate at whatever pace you

  choose. But, pop the hood and prepare yourself for the snarling

  beast that resides beneath the hood. The numbers-matching KX

  option-coded V-8, measuring a massive 425 cubic inches, and is fed

  by a dual-quad carburetor, making this car just one of 2,122 made

  with this engine configuration. The "Super" in Super Wildcat

  denotes the incredible power this particular engine is capable of

  producing. How does 360 horsepower and locomotive-level 465

  pound-feet of torque sound? If you said "super," that's what we

  were thinking too.

  That power is sent through a three-speed TH400 automatic

  transmission and onto a Buick 9.38-inch rear end. Sitting at all

  four corners is a set of 17-inch US Mags wheels shod in 215/55R-17

  tires, while an independent front and three-link rear suspension

  handle handling duties.

  Inside, you're greeted by custom white vinyl seats, both front and

  rear, that provide a comfortable view of the road for all

  passengers involved. The stock dashboard is highlighted by the two

  big gauges front and center of the driver, while the woodgrain and

  aluminum trim panels keep this car's original appearance and appeal

  as a reminder that this car was built for luxurious travel to and

  from just about anywhere. Power steering, power brakes, and even

  power door locks all complete the package of this Super Wildcat's

  vintage appeal, allowing it to do exactly what it was made for...

  cruising in style.
